12.2.5 Drive safety functions
The following drive-related safety functions can be used:
STO (Safe Torque Off according to EN61800-5-2) by disconnecting the STO in-
put.
If the STO function is activated, the frequency inverter no longer supplies power to
the motor for generating torque. This drive safety function corresponds to a non-
controlled stop according to EN60204-1, stop category 0.
The STO input must be disabled by a suitable external safety controller/safety re-
lay.

SS1(c) (SS1-t) (safe stop 1, with time control according to EN 61800-5-2) by
means of suitable external control (e.g. safety relay with delayed disconnection).
The following sequence is mandatory:
Decelerate the drive using an appropriate deceleration ramp specified via set-
points.
Disconnect the STO input (= triggering the STO function) after a specified
safety-related time delay.
This drive safety function corresponds to a controlled stop according to
EN60204‑1, stop category 1.
